I have an i7 7700 with a 3060ti and 32gb RAM, installed on m.2. The game runs smooth while exploring and fighting indoors, but some outside spaces you will see your cpu max out and performance dips, but not game breakingly so. I just got to Akila City and the CPU is slammed. This is on medium settings but I'm still tweaking to get the best performance without impacting quality too much. The 4cores/8threads are pushed to its limits but it is playable.

edit:
Indoors: 100+ fps
Busy outside areas: avg 45 fps on medium. 35-40 on high.
